The silent cry japanese manen gannen no futtoboru, literally football in the first year of manen is a novel by japanese author kenzaburo oe, first published in japanese in 1967 and awarded the tanizaki prize that year. The silent cry traces the uneasy relationship between two brothers who return to their ancestral home, a village in densely forested western japan.
